Championing youth voices and leadership in the UK
The British Youth Council, supported by the National Youth Agency, is dedicated to giving young people in the UK a platform to speak up, get involved, and shape their communities. The site highlights the importance of youth voices and offers a range of resources, inspiring stories, and support networks to help young people become active leaders.
Whether you want to learn about youth work, find opportunities to participate in events, or connect with peer networks, this website makes it easy to get involved. There are tools for local authorities, policy updates, and ways to join initiatives like the UK Youth Parliament. If you're passionate about making a difference or want to see what young people are achieving across the UK, this site is a welcoming place to start.
